常用的Adb命令
- adb命令抓取log日志android & ios
- adb logcat | findstr packages >路徑+txt文件名稱
- adb bugreport >指定的路徑
- Android系統>=8.0,直接執行
- 針對Android系統版本<8.0,終端切至路徑C:\Users\ymlu\Desktop\adt-bundle-windows-x86_64-20140702\adt-bundle-windows-x86_64-20140702\sdk\platform-tools下面,運行adb.exe;然后運行adb bugreport即可
- Windows電腦上抓取ios 手機APP日志的方法:可以用iTools工具
- 下載安裝itools工具:http://www.mydown.com/soft/59/11963059.shtml
- 插上ios手機之后要先安裝驅動,驅動安裝成功才能連上ios手機
- 點擊“工具箱”,點擊“實時日志”,ios上所有APP的日志都能打印出來
- 查看包名:adb shell pm list packages
- 保存log:adb logcat -v time > log.txt
- 查看進程pid:adb shell ps |findstr PackageName
- 例如 adb shell ps |findstr monkey
- adb shell kill pid
- 電池電量:adb shell dumpsys battery |findstr level
- 內存:adb shell dumpsys meminfo PackageName
- cpu占用:adb shell top/mitop | findstr PackageName
- 啟動應用:adb shell am start -n <package_name>/.<activity_class_name>
- 錄制屏幕視頻:adb shell screenrecord --bugreport /sdcard/launch.mp4
- 查看手機硬件信息:adb shell cat /proc/hwinfo
- 查看wifi密碼:adb shell cat /data/misc/wifi/*.conf
- 獲取設備名稱:adb shell cat /system/build.prop
- 獲取屬性信息:adb shell getprop
- 設置某項屬性值:adb shell setprop <key> <value>
- 獲取機器MAC地址:adb shell cat /sys/class/net/wlan0/address
- 獲取CPU序列號:adb shell cat /proc/cpuinfo
- 獲取設備分辨率:adb shell wm size
- 安裝應用:adb install 安裝包路徑
- 卸載應用:adb uninstall 包名
- 將文件放在設備內:adb push 文件路徑 /sdcard(設備路徑)
- 斷電:adb shell dumpsys battery unplug
- 設置為“x”電量 :adb shell dumpsys battery set level x
- 重置 :adb shell dumpsys battery reset
- 手機設置為非充電狀態:adb shell dumpsys battery set status 1設置非充電狀態
- 設備設置為不充電(查看設備為未充電):
adb shell
cd /sys/class/power_supply/battery
echo 1 > input_suspend(停止充電)
echo 0 > input_suspend(恢復充電)
- 查IMEI:adb shell getprop | findstr imei
- 進入fastboot模式:
- power+音量下鍵
- Adb reboot bootloader
- 手動解鎖命令:adb reboot bootloader-->fastboot flashing unlock_critical


浙公網安備 33010602011771號